Attachment 1 <br /> STATEMENT OF APPROVAL AND CONSISTENCY <br /> OF A PROPOSED UNIFIED DEVELOPMENT ORDINANCE TEXT AMENDMENT <br /> WITH ADOPTED ORANGE COUNTY PLANS <br /> Orange County has initiated amendments to the Unified Development Ordinance <br /> ( UDO ) in to ensure that County regulations are : Consistent with NC General Statute ( NCGS ) <br /> Chapter 160D - 804 . 1 ( Performance Guarantees ) ; NC Administrative Code ( NCAC ) Title 15A <br /> Subchapter . 0277 ( Falls Reservoir Water Supply Nutrient Strategy) ; NCAC Title 15A <br /> Subchapter 02B . 0711 ( Neuse Nutrient Strategy) ; NCAC Title 15A Chapter 04 ( Sedimentation <br /> Control ) ; NCAC Title 15A Subchapter 02H . 1000 through . 1063 ( Stormwater Management) ; <br /> the North Carolina State Sedimentation Control Commission ' s ( SCC ) most current Model Local <br /> Ordinance for Soil Erosion and Sedimentation Control ; and the North Carolina Division of j <br /> Water Resources ' ( NCDWR ' s ) most current Model Stormwater Ordinances . <br /> c <br /> The Board of County Commissioners hereby approves the proposed text amendment <br /> and finds : <br /> a . The requirements of Section 2 . 8 Zoning Atlas and Unified Development Ordinance j <br /> Amendments of the UDO have been deemed complete ; and , <br /> b . Pursuant to Sections 1 . 1 . 5 Statement of Intent - Amendments , and 1 . 1 . 7 <br /> Conformance with Adopted Plans of the UDO and to Section 160D .604 (d ) Planning <br /> board review and comment — Plan consistency and 160D .605 ( a ) Governing board <br /> r <br /> statement — Plan consistency of the North Carolina General Statutes , the Board <br /> finds sufficient documentation within the record denoting that the amendment is <br /> consistent with the adopted 2030 Comprehensive Plan . <br /> 1 . The amendment is consistent with applicable plans because it supports the <br /> following : <br /> • Land Use Goal 6 of the 2030 Comprehensive Plan — A land use j <br /> planning process that is transparent, fair, open, efficient, and <br /> responsive . <br /> These amendments are consistent with this goal and <br /> objective by ensuring that County regulations are consistent <br /> with the most current State laws and State guidance <br /> documents pertaining to erosion and sedimentation control <br /> and stormwater management while also maintaining the <br /> intent of existing regulations . By adopting the amendment , <br /> the County will be operating in accordance with the <br /> authorities granted to it by the State . <br /> c . The amendment is reasonable and in the public interest because it : <br /> 1 . Ensures legal sufficiency by conforming the County ' s land development <br /> regulations to State of North Carolina General Statutes and guidance <br /> documents . <br /> The Board of County Commissioners hereby adopts this Statement of Approval and <br /> Consistency as well as the findings expressed herein . j <br /> Renee Price , Chair Date <br />
